Do and don’ts in laboratory?

In a laboratory setting, adhering to safety protocols and best practices is crucial to ensure a safe and productive environment. This guide outlines the essential do’s and don’ts in a laboratory to help you navigate your lab work effectively and safely.

What Are the Essential Do’s in a Laboratory?

Follow Safety Protocols

  • Wear appropriate personal protective equipment (PPE): Always use lab coats, gloves, goggles, and other necessary PPE to protect yourself from potential hazards.
  • Familiarize yourself with emergency procedures: Know the location of emergency exits, fire extinguishers, eyewash stations, and first aid kits.

Maintain a Clean and Organized Workspace

  • Keep your work area tidy: A cluttered workspace can lead to accidents. Regularly clean your area and dispose of waste properly.
  • Label all containers: Ensure that all chemicals and samples are clearly labeled to avoid mix-ups and potential hazards.

Handle Chemicals and Equipment Properly

  • Read labels and material safety data sheets (MSDS): Understand the properties and risks associated with the chemicals you are using.
  • Use equipment according to instructions: Follow the manufacturer’s guidelines to prevent equipment damage and ensure accurate results.

Practice Good Documentation

  • Record all experiments meticulously: Keep detailed notes of procedures, observations, and results to ensure reproducibility and accountability.
  • Update lab logs regularly: Document any changes or incidents promptly to maintain accurate records.

What Are the Key Don’ts in a Laboratory?

Avoid Unsafe Practices

  • Don’t eat or drink in the lab: Consuming food or beverages can lead to contamination and exposure to hazardous substances.
  • Don’t work alone: Always have a colleague present, especially when handling dangerous materials or conducting high-risk experiments.

Prevent Cross-Contamination

  • Don’t use the same gloves for different tasks: Change gloves when switching between different substances or procedures to prevent cross-contamination.
  • Don’t return unused chemicals to their original containers: This can lead to contamination and compromise the integrity of the chemicals.

Handle Waste Properly

  • Don’t dispose of chemicals down the sink: Follow proper waste disposal protocols to prevent environmental contamination and adhere to regulatory requirements.
  • Don’t ignore spills: Clean up spills immediately using appropriate materials and report them to your supervisor.

People Also Ask

What Should You Do in Case of a Laboratory Accident?

In the event of an accident, remain calm and follow these steps:

  1. Assess the situation and ensure your safety.
  2. Alert your supervisor and colleagues.
  3. Use emergency equipment like eyewash stations or fire extinguishers if needed.
  4. Document the incident and any injuries sustained.

How Can You Improve Laboratory Safety?

Improving lab safety involves regular training, updating safety protocols, and conducting safety audits. Encourage open communication about safety concerns and continuously educate staff on new procedures and equipment.

Why Is Proper Lab Documentation Important?

Proper documentation ensures that experiments can be replicated and results verified. It provides a clear record of what was done, which is crucial for troubleshooting and future research. Good documentation practices also uphold scientific integrity.

What Are Common Laboratory Hazards?

Common laboratory hazards include chemical exposure, biological agents, sharp objects, and equipment malfunctions. Awareness and adherence to safety protocols can mitigate these risks.

How Often Should Lab Equipment Be Maintained?

Lab equipment should be maintained according to the manufacturer’s guidelines, typically every 6-12 months. Regular maintenance ensures accuracy, prolongs equipment life, and prevents unexpected breakdowns.
